According to the generally accepted definition, a ‘pledge’ is a bailment of personal property as security for some debt or engagement, redeemable on certain terms, and with an implied power of sale on default. Unlike a pledge, a ‘charge’ is not a transfer of property of one to another. It is a right created in favour of one, referred to as “the lender” in the immovable property of another, referred to as “the borrower”, as security for repayment of the loan and payment of interest on the terms and conditions contained in the loan documents evidencing charge. In the situation of an organization in a excessive-risk trade, understanding which property are tangible and intangible helps to evaluate its solvency and threat. ‘Crystallisation’ of a floating charge is triggered by an occasion corresponding to default on reimbursement of the mortgage or a receiver or administrator being appointed to the company. Upon crystallisation, the charge turns into fixed and attaches to the assets and the lender can enforce its rights to recover the debt.

This will embrace any failure to meet the terms of the mortgage (non-payment, etc.), or if the corporate goes into liquidation, ceases to commerce, and so forth. Depending on the drafting of the instrument creating the floating cost, some events will enable the lender to declare that the floating cost has crystallised, while different occasions might imply that the floating charge crystallises mechanically. A floating charge will crystallise mechanically at widespread regulation on the incidence of sure events, such because the borrower ceasing to carry on its business or coming into into liquidation.

Some examples of pledge are gold /jewelry loans, advance against goods or stock, advances against National Saving Certificates etc. The asset can only be sold by the pledgee after giving reasonable reminder and notice to the pledgor.

A floating charge is a security interest or lien over a group of non-constant assets, that change in quantity and value. The assets used in a floating charge are usually short-term current assets that the company consumes within one year. Fixed cost holders are first in line for reimbursement and obtain the cash they are owed from the sale of the asset they hold a set charge over. Floating cost holders must wait till fixed cost holders, preferential creditors similar to workers and the insolvency practitioner have obtained the money they’re owed earlier than they’re repaid.

Where cash borrowed by an organization is secured by a floating cost over the company’s property and enterprise, the company could continue trading and eliminate any belongings in the midst of that enterprise. It provides the enterprise much more freedom than a set cost because the business can promote, switch or dispose of these belongings with out in search of approval from the lender or having to repay the debt first. When a lender has a fixed charge, it effectively has full management over the asset the cost applies to. If the business desires to promote, transfer or eliminate the asset, it should get permission from the lender first or repay the remaining debt.
